Population Overview

Stewartstown is a small community located in Pennsylvania, within York County. The total population is 1,761. It ranks as the 713th most populous out of 1,991 Census-designated places in Pennsylvania.

Age Demographics

The median age in Stewartstown is 42.8 years. This is 5% higher than the state median of 40.9 years. 10.3% of residents are 75 or older, suggesting a significant retirement-age population with implications for healthcare services and senior housing.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Stewartstown is $81,250. This is 4% higher than the state median of $77,971. It is also about the same as the national median of $80,734. The poverty rate stands at 9.5%. This is 19% lower than the state poverty rate of 11.7%. The unemployment rate is 5.7%. This is 9% higher than the state rate of 5.3%. The median home value is $267,500. Housing costs are 5% higher than the state median of $254,500. The home-value-to-income ratio is 3.3x. 64.7%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 7% lower than the state average of 69.3%.

Race & Ethnicity

The largest racial or ethnic group in Stewartstown is White (non-Hispanic), making up 83.1% of the population.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 5.4%. The Black or African American population (4.0%) is well below the state average of 10.3%. The Asian population (1.2%) is well below the state average of 3.8%.

Education

33.5%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 5% lower than the state rate of 35.2%. Nationally, 35.7%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 93.7%. Notably, 16.3% of adults hold a graduate or professional degree, indicating a highly educated workforce.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Stewartstown, Pennsylvania is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 2020–2024 5-Year Estimates. The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ually and pools five years of responses so that even small communities can be measured, though the margin of error widens as the population falls. Comparisons are made against Pennsylvania state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 1,991 Census-designated places in Pennsylvania.
